Product Details

From the living room to the bedroom, from the hall to the kitchen, this framed mini-print of iconic images of Manchester will look instantly at home, whether you live there or are looking for a nostalgic reminder of your home town. Designed to reflect the splendour, past and present, of this memorably marvellous city – the heritage of the cotton mills, modernistic architecture, the music scene, football, trams, cinema, the Ship Canal or the Northern Quarter - this mini-print makes the perfect gift for Mancunians of all ages.


Drawn by illustrator, Martha Mitchell, in her Brighton Studio each digital print is signed and dated on top quality pure white archival paper.

Available in a black or white frame.

Box frame made from polcore (recycled polystyrene) with glass

Frame Size: Size: H16cm x W16cm x D3cm
